Ogre and Ogre Mage are level 4 creatures of Stronghold town. They are recruited from the Ogre Fort.

"Wielding great wooden clubs, ogres and ogre mages deal good damage and are very durable. Ogre magi can cast the Bloodlust spell on any allied troop, once per round." RoE manual

Tactics and info

Ogre Magi cast Bloodlust three times per battle at the advanced level.

Though hindered by their slow speed, Ogres and Ogre Magi have the highest attack and health of any 4th level unit in the game. However, their defense is still low.

Trivia

In one of the Armageddon's Blade teasers, the Ogre was shown shooting a beam of energy from his staff towards a Dendroid. The reason for that is because the teaser animations were already done and were supposed to show a Stinger or Bruiser instead, the Forge version of the Ogre, which bore a rocket launcher or Bazooka. However, due to fan backlash, they had to change the Forge creatures into "regular" creatures, and so the teaser became somewhat off-topic with ranged Goblins, a Minotaur and an Ogre guarding the Varn Vault where the Armageddon's Blade was kept.
